Quadruple VS Nuance Contrast & Social Differences

When expressing "taste" in Japanese, you must carefully distinguish between "味わう", "好み", "風情", "嗜好" based on context.
  • 味わう (あじわう (ajiwau) - Level: N3): Maps to "to taste; to savor; to experience" and is used when Primarily means to taste food, but can also mean to experience or appreciate something.
  • 好み (このみ (konomi) - Level: N3): Maps to "taste; preference; liking" and is used when Refers to what someone likes or prefers.
  • 風情 (ふぜい (fuzei) - Level: N2): Maps to "taste, elegance, charm, atmosphere, ambience" and is used when Refers to the aesthetic quality, charm, or atmosphere that evokes a sense of beauty, tranquility, or nostalgia, often related to traditional Japanese aesthetics..
  • 嗜好 (しこう (shikō) - Level: N1): Maps to "taste; liking; preference (especially for food, drink, or hobbies)" and is used when Refers to one's preferences or tastes, often in a more general or psychological sense than 「好み.

Context for "味わう"
ゆっくりワインの味を味わった。
I slowly savored the taste of the wine.
Context for "好み"
人それぞれ好みがあります。
Everyone has their own preferences.
Context for "風情"
雪が降る中で露天風呂に入るのは、また格別の風情がある。
Taking an open-air bath while it's snowing has a truly special charm.
Context for "嗜好"
個人の嗜好に合わせて商品を選ぶ。
Choose products according to personal preferences.
